Surat Municipal Institute of Medical Education & Research (SMIMER) is a prominent public medical college located in Surat, Gujarat. It is directly managed by the Surat Municipal Corporation (SMC), which makes it a Municipal Government Institution. It was established in 2000 to provide high-quality medical education and advanced healthcare services to the city.
The college is academically affiliated with Veer Narmad South Gujarat University (VNSGU), Surat. This means SMIMER follows the curriculum and examination schedule set by VNSGU, which awards the final degrees (MBBS, MD/MS).
Type: Semi-Government (Municipal Corporation - SMC)
Affiliation: Veer Narmad South Gujarat University (VNSGU), Surat
Recognition: Fully recognized by the National Medical Commission (NMC)
Established: 2000
Recognized for 150 seats. Permitted for increase of seats from 150 to 200 under EWS quota (103rd constitution amendment) for 2019-20, Permitted for increase of seats from 200 to 250 under EWS quota under (103rd constitution amendment) for 2022-23. Permitted (1st renewal) and 2nd batch for the Academic Year 2023 - 2024. Annual renewal permission granted for 250 MBBS seats for AY 2024-25.

The college is attached to its own massive municipal government hospital that serves as its primary teaching facility.
Flagship Hospital: The SMIMER Hospital is the primary constituent teaching hospital, fully integrated with the medical college.
Scale & Services: SMIMER Hospital is a major tertiary care referral hospital for the South Gujarat region.
Capacity: A large hospital with 870+ beds.
Services: Provides comprehensive healthcare services across all clinical specialties and numerous super-specialties. It features 24x7 Emergency & Trauma, extensive Critical Care units (ICUs), modern Operation Theatres, a licensed Blood Bank, and massive OPD/IPD services.
Patient Load: The hospital handles an exceptionally high patient inflow, providing students with unparalleled clinical exposure, which is the college's biggest strength.
Educational Engine: The SMIMER Hospital is the core clinical training ground for all SMIMER students.

Getting Admitted (MBBS/MD/MS): Admission is strictly and exclusively based on qualifying ranks in NEET-UG (for MBBS) or NEET-PG (for MD/MS).
State Counselling is Key (Gujarat): Seat allotment for all categories (Government Quota, Management Quota, and NRI Quota) is handled entirely through the Gujarat State Centralized Counselling Process conducted by the Admission Committee for Professional Undergraduate Medical Educational Courses (ACPUGMEC), Gujarat.

Career Path: As an established, high-volume municipal medical college, the career path for graduates is excellent.
Internship: MBBS graduates complete a mandatory 1-year rotatory internship at the SMIMER Hospital, for which they receive a competitive stipend as per state government/municipal norms.
Bond: A service bond (e.g., 1 year) and course breakage bond may be required, as is common with government-society colleges.
Post-Graduation: The extensive clinical exposure and the availability of 190+ PG seats make graduates highly competitive for PG seats (via NEET-PG) or immediately employable as Medical Officers.
